Logo Make it Real

Backend Developer con Ruby on Rails

Aprenderás a diseñar, implementar y desplegar Web APIs robustas con Ruby on Rails.

Sept 6, 2022
Inicio
9 semanas
Duración
Martes y Jueves de 6pm a 8pm
Sábados de 9am a 11am
Remoto (videollamada)
Ubicación

¿A quién está dirigido?

Buscamos personas con conocimientos en desarrollo Web utilizando otros lenguajes programación (Java, PHP, Python, Node.js, etc.) que deseen aprender desarrollo Backend con Ruby on Rails para encontrar nuevas oportunidades laborales, crear sus propios emprendimientos o aprender nuevas tecnologías.

Testimonios

Currículo

Fase nivelación 1 semana

Ruby: las características, sintaxis, controles de flujo, arreglos, hashes, funciones, excepciones y librerías del lenguaje.

Fase principal 9 semanas

Aprenderás a crear el backend de aplicaciones Web con Ruby on Rails y PostgreSQL. Además, tendrás acceso a nuestra plataforma de aprendizaje en donde podrás reforzar los conocimientos aprendidos en clase.

Módulo 1

Programación Orientada por Objetos: clases, objetos, métodos, atributos de clase, herencia, polimorfismo y módulos.

Módulo 2

PostgreSQL: aprenderás sobre bases de datos relacionales y SQL.

Módulo 3

Ruby on Rails: instalación, arquitectura, creación de proyectos, rutas, controladores, modelos, recursos REST, entre otros.

Módulo 4

Active Record: Consultas, asociaciones, validaciones, scopes, callbacks, migraciones.

Módulo 5

Autenticación, carga de archivos (Active), Web Sockets (ActionCable), background jobs (ActiveJob), despliegue con Heroku.

Módulo 6

Pruebas automatizadas unitarias, de integración y pruebas en paralelo.

Fase online 3 meses

Vas a seguir teniendo acceso a la plataforma para que continues tu aprendizaje y profundices los temas que más te interesen.

Nuestros Mentores

Mantente informado

¡Descarga nuestro e-book completamente gratis!

Recibe además contenido exclusivo, información de nuestros Bootcamps, webinars y otros eventos.

Preguntas frecuentes

¿Por qué existe Make it Real?

Por dos razones principalmente. Por un lado existe una desconexión entre la academia y la industria. Las empresas no están encontrando las personas con los conocimientos que necesitan, pero muchos profesionales siguen sin empleo.

La segunda razón es que, desafortunadamente, la mayoría de la educación está mal implementada. La clase magistral y las calificaciones son obsoletas. Creemos que es el momento de repensar la educación.

¿Por qué Ruby on Rails?

Ruby on Rails porque es un framework muy expresivo, fácil de aprender y con una gran comunidad de desarrolladores en el mundo.

Además, los desarrolladores que trabajan con Ruby on Rails están en alta demanda por las empresas con muy buenos salarios.

¿Cuáles son los requisitos?

Para el curso necesitas:

  • Un computador personal con mínimo 8GB de RAM.
  • Conexión a Internet de al menos 5Mbps.
  • Conocimientos previos en desarrollo Web.

¿Es posible ver todos los temas que proponen en el curso?

Depende de tus conocimientos previos y tu ritmo de aprendizaje. Pero no te preocupes, igual tendrás acceso a nuestra plataforma de aprendizaje con videos, retos y recursos por 3 meses más después de terminado el curso para que lo termines o profundices lo que desees.